‘They don’t give a f***’: Bungling contract killers murdering the wrong people
Now, an insider claims the ordeal highlights the terrifying reality ushered in by these new rent-a-killers, who are consistently “getting it wrong” with devastating consequences.
The senior police source, who can’t be identified but who has many years of experience on Sydney’s streets rubbing shoulders with underworld figures, told news.com.au this new cohort “lacked the intelligence, the investment, and the care of their predecessors”.
“And Mr Baghsarian and his devastated family paid the ultimate price,” the officer said
“The people sent to do the shooting are given a car loaded with gear and an address. They fulfil a task. They do not do their own intel work prior.
A new breed of crooks is stalking our streets, driven by a hollow craving for infamy and a desire to make a quick buck.
But with no skin in the game, they are sloppy and prone to screw-ups.
These days the criminals are organising the hits from overseas and “setting them up with strangers on signal”.

An 85-year-old grandfather who was allegedly kidnapped in a case of mistaken identity and tortured had his finger cut off with a handsaw, police will allege.
The timing of the finger’s removal – whether pre or post-mortem – remains unclear, though it is believed Chris Baghsarian died within 48 hours of being dragged from his bed in North Ryde, in Sydney’s northwest.
Court documents reveal details of the alleged crime, including claims that Daniel Stevens, 24, and Gerard Andrews, 29, were part of the kidnap crew.
Police allege the pair went shopping at Kmart (like Walmart) days before the abduction, purchasing black tracksuit pants, T-shirts, and three black hoodies.
In one harrowing video, a man is seen holding a curtain over Mr Baghsarian’s face, demanding, “What is Dimmy (Dimitri) and Dom’s numbers?” – apparently referring to Mr Stepanyan’s sons. Neither of the sons are accused of any wrongdoing.
In the hours after the abduction, Stevens allegedly left the Dural property for a “Maccas run”, also picking up refreshments and a first aid kit and gloves from Bunnings.
